Common Signs Your Commercial Heating System Needs Repair

Your heating system often gives warning signs before it fails completely. Catching these early can save you significant time and expense. However, many business owners overlook the early signals until the problem becomes urgent.

Here are some of the most common indicators that your system needs professional attention:

  • Uneven heating — Some rooms are warm while others stay cold.
  • Strange noises — Banging, rattling, or squealing sounds from the unit.
  • Higher energy bills — A sudden spike in costs often signals inefficiency.
  • Short cycling — The system turns on and off repeatedly without fully heating the space.
  • Weak airflow — Vents are running but output feels reduced.
  • Burning smells — Any unusual odor from the system warrants immediate inspection.
  • System won’t start — The unit fails to turn on at all.

If you notice any of these warning signs, do not wait. Instead, schedule a professional inspection as soon as possible to prevent a complete breakdown.

Short Cycling and What It Means

Short cycling is one of the more misunderstood heating problems. It occurs when the system starts, runs briefly, then shuts off before completing a full heating cycle. This puts extra strain on the equipment over time.

Furthermore, short cycling reduces efficiency and increases wear on components. Common causes include a dirty air filter, a faulty thermostat, or an oversized unit. A qualified technician can diagnose the root cause accurately and recommend the right repair path.

Ignition and Pilot Light Issues

Gas-fired commercial heaters rely on consistent ignition to operate safely. When the pilot light fails or the ignition system malfunctions, the unit simply will not produce heat. Additionally, ignition problems can sometimes point to gas supply or pressure issues.

These are not repairs to attempt without training. Always call a licensed HVAC professional when you suspect an ignition or gas-related issue. Safety must come first on every job.

Preventive Maintenance: The Best Way to Avoid Emergency Repairs

The most effective heating repair strategy is avoiding breakdowns in the first place. Preventive maintenance keeps your system running efficiently and helps extend its useful life. Additionally, routine inspections catch small issues before they escalate into major failures.

A solid commercial HVAC maintenance plan typically includes:

  • Filter inspection and replacement
  • Cleaning of burners and heat exchangers
  • Inspection of electrical connections and controls
  • Lubrication of moving components
  • Thermostat calibration and testing
  • Flue and venting checks for gas-fired systems
  • Rooftop unit inspection for weather damage

For businesses in high-elevation areas like Stateline, we recommend scheduling maintenance at least twice per year — before summer and before winter. This timing ensures your system is ready before the harshest seasonal demands hit.

Energy Efficiency and Your Bottom Line

A well-maintained heating system uses less energy to produce the same output. As a result, regular maintenance directly reduces your monthly utility costs. Over the course of a season, those savings can add up meaningfully for a commercial operation.

On the other hand, a neglected system works harder, cycles more often, and consumes more fuel or electricity. In a high-traffic commercial property, the difference in energy costs between a maintained and unmaintained system can be significant.
